Benefits of Sugar Waxing
For those of us who've had a bad experience with waxing, sugaring can be a godsend. It's made with just three ingredients—sugar, lemon fruktdryck, and salt—so it's free of skin-irritating chemicals and toxins. And it’s practically free to man, too!
But there's other reasons to love sugar waxing:
Less breakage and ingrown hairs. Because you remove hair in the direction it grows, it's gentler on the hair and skin, which means fewer ingrown hairs.
Plus, the sugar wax wraps around the hair follicle and stays soft during the entire process, so there's less chance of breakage.
There's no chance of getting burned. "With traditional waxing it fryst vatten up to the skill set of the practitioner to control the temperature and technique of the procedure," says Robyn Newmark, esthetician and founder of Newmark Beauty.
"Sugaring can be done more often with less trauma although neither technique should be creating trauma if done correctly."
Clean up fryst vatten a breeze. Sugar wax melts right off when it comes in contact with vatten. So if there's any lingering wax on your skin, a wet washcloth will do the trick.
Sugar wax can be reapplied. If you missed a prick, feel free to apply sugar wax to the same area several times without adverse effects.
It's super gentle. Sugar wax won't stick to live skin cells, so it doesn't rip off a layer of skin when you pull.
This means it's less painful than traditional waxing, and you won't have the wounds to boot.
Better for the environment. Sugaring fryst vatten also more sustainable in many respects! "Sugaring paste fryst vatten biodegradable (food grade) and creates less waste, as it eliminates the need for sticks and strips," explains Tami Blake, licensed esthetician and founder of Sweet + True.
"In fact, you can use the same ball of paste throughout the entire service!"

How to Apply Sugar Wax
While sugaring fryst vatten a lot like traditional waxing, there are a couple differences:
1. Let the wax cool to room temperature. Unlike traditional wax, sugar wax doesn't need to be hot to work.
2. Once cool, scoop the wax out of the bur and apply it with a butter knife, popsicle stick, or your hands.
To man sugar wax, first add 1 cup (225 grams) of granulated sugar to a medium-sized pot.You'll want to apply a ¼-inch layer of wax against the direction of the hair and gently press it onto your skin.
3. Pull the skin taught. Then get a good hold off the wax and, with a quick flick of your wrist, pull in the direction of hair growth.
4. You can roll the wax between your palms and re-use it on different sections of skin until it's no längre sticky.
One cup of sugar wax should gods for several applications, so man sure to rädda any leftovers in the refrigerator and gently warm prior to use.
What to do Before and After You Sugar Wax
A good pre- and post-wax routine will help keep pain, ingrowns and infection to a minimum.
Here's how to baby your skin before and after sugaring.
Before Waxing
1. Let hair grow a bit. A good rule of thumb fryst vatten to let hair grow to about ¼” before waxing. Anything shorter and the wax won’t stick to the hair shaft very easily, meaning you’ll end up with a splotchy wax job. How long fryst vatten ¼ of an inch?
Well, if you currently:
-Shave – it’s about 10-14 days of growth
-Wax – it’s about 4 weeks of growth
-Sugar – it’s about 4-6 weeks of growth
2. Tackle flakes. For the best results, Blake recommends gently exfoliating the skin before your first appointment and in between appointments.
Try using a loofah, sugar scrub, or bath okänt 3 days before sugaring. This should be just enough time to remove flakes while still allowing any micro-tears or irritation to heal.
3. Skip the sweat session. Excessive sweating can open pores, which may man your skin more prone to infection. So, don’t do anything that can cause excessive sweating within 24 hours of sugaring, such as visiting the sauna, working out, taking a hot yoga class or soaking in the tub.
4.
Don’t have too much caffeine and alcohol before. Drinking and caffeine can man you more prone to bleeding, notes esthetician, Mehvish Patel. She also recommends avoiding the use of any retinoid creams for at least 24-48 hours beforehand.
5. Avoid sun exposure. solbränna and sugar waxing don’t mix (all inom can säga fryst vatten ouch!) Stay out of the sun for at least 48 hours prior to sugaring.
If that’s not possible, at least cover any areas you strategi to wax.
6. Skip the bath and body products. Don’t apply luktneutraliserare, makeup, lotion, perfume or any other body products the day of your wax möte.

After Waxing
Just like before your wax möte, you should baby your skin for 24-48 hours after you wax.
1. Let your skin breath. Wear loose-fitting clothes and avoid all bath and body products, such as lotions, makeup, luktneutraliserare, and creams on freshly waxed skin for 48 hours.
After 48 hours, begin applying an all-natural moisturizer to replenish moisture and soothe skin.
2. Exfoliate. Starting 2 days post-wax, gently exfoliate to keep skin smooth and free of ingrown hairs. Use a dry brush or exfoliating glove, and move in a gentle, rund motion.
Everything you need to know about how to sugar wax.Repeat every 3-4 days.
3. Avoid sweat sessions. Just like before, don’t work out, spend time in the sun or do anything that may cause excessive sweating for 48 hours after waxing.
4. Don't touch. Avoid touching, scratching or picking at recently waxed skin.

What if my sugar wax comes out too hard?
If your sugar wax consistently comes out too hard, you're overcooking it.
Add more lemon fruktdryck (the exact amount you need depends on how hard the sugar mix is) and continue boiling for another 1–2 minutes.
If it's still not pliable enough, add more lemon fruktsaft and keep boiling.
Once it's overcooked, sometimes the easiest thing to do fryst vatten to kasta it out and uppstart over again.
If you've tried batch after batch and it's always too hard, forget using the thermometer and just try cooking it for a shorter amount of time. And don't let your sugar wax cool in the metall pot you cooked it in, or it will overcook because it keeps cooking even after you take it off the burner.
What if it comes out too soft?
If it's not hard enough and doesn't adhere to the hair, you're undercooking it.
The only solution for that fryst vatten to cook it longer.
You can try to get it to the right consistency bygd putting it back in the pot on the burner and heating it for another few minutes.

I've tried this recipe 'x' times, and it still won't komma out right.
Now what?
For a variety of reasons, there isn't a one-size-fits-all sugar wax recipe. Here are a few of the potential issues that might affect how your wax turns out:
It could be the climate you live in (more moisture in the air will affect your sugar wax), or it could be your supplies.
Your thermometer isn't calibrated correctly or it's not sensitive enough.
Your burner gets too hot and the liquid evaporates too quickly.
Maybe when you removed the wax from the stove, it kept cooking (this fryst vatten a big bekymmer for a lot of people), so even if it was perfect when you turned off the heat, it may have burned as it sat.
As always, if this recipe doesn't work for you, another one might work better.
Keep ansträngande until you find a method you like.

How to man Sugar Wax At Home
Equipment
Materials
- 2 cups white sugar
- ¼ cup lemon juice
- 2 tablespoons water
- 1 teaspoon salt
Instructions
- Add all ingredients to a pot, and without rörande, vända the heat to medium-high (stirring can cause sugar to crystalize on the sides of your pot).
If you have one, attach your candy thermometer to the side of the saucepan so you can watch the temperature closely as it cooks.
- Once the sugar mixture starts to boil, gently virvel the pot to mix the ingredients.
- Keep a close eye on the mixture and cook until it turns the color of honey or until your thermometer reads 260 degrees F (this took about 5 minutes for me, but it could vary depending on the storlek of your saucepan).
- Immediately remove wax from the heat and transfer it to a glass jar to stop the cooking process (the wax can krossa cold glass, so run your jar beneath hot vatten for a minute to prep it for the wax).
Meanwhile, take a spoonful of wax and put it in the freezer. Wait until it has cooled completely, then betalningsmedel the consistency. It should be stretchy like a del av helhet of bubble gum and slightly sticky. If it's too runny, return wax to the pot and boil for another 30 seconds. If it's too hard (like crunchy candy), either add more vatten and boil a little längre or throw it out and början over.
- Once your wax fryst vatten the right consistency, let it cool completely before applying to skin.
